Set QuickTime to open QTIF by default

Change default apps on Mac

  1. Right-click or use Control + Left-click on the desired QTIF file to access the file’s context menu;
  2. Choose "Open in Application" and click "Other";
  3. At the bottom of the window, you will find the "Enable" menu. Default, will be set to "Recommended Programs";
  4. Choose "All Programs" in this menu and search for QuickTime. Check the box next to "Always open in app" to make it the default program.

Change default programs in Windows

  1. Take the first step by right-clicking on your QTIF file. Next, select "Open With" and then choose "Choose another app" from the available options;
  2. Find the QuickTime application in the pop-up window and select it as your preferred program;
  3. Select the "Always use this application" check box and click "OK" to save your selection as the default application for opening QTIF files.
